Poste Italiane, collective agreement renewed: 103 euros more and supplementary pension

Poste Italiane and the trade unions have signed the renewal of the collective labor agreement for the group's non-executive personnel for the three-year period 2016-2018. As stated in a note, the agreement is divided into three macro areas: economic treatment, which provides an overall average monthly increase of 103 euros per employee, new corporate welfare institutes (health fund e supplementary pension) and changes to the system of industrial relations.

“The agreement with the trade union organizations – commented the managing director of Poste, Matteo Del Fante – was signed at the end of a negotiation that lasted many months in which we have always found a constructive and responsible climate between the parties. Today the market poses important challenges to which we are called to respond with an effort of productivity and a common commitment”.

The trade unions, concludes the note from Poste, "have expressed unanimous appreciation for the effort made by the company and for the defense of workers' rights and for their safety and economic stability".
